Looking for one of the most iconic local foods near Dongdaemun? Dakhanmari is a must-try Korean chicken soup experience in Jongno.
Served as a whole chicken simmered in a large pot, this dish is simple but deeply comforting—especially after a long day of walking in Seoul.
